首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
考研
已知一个二叉树,用二叉链表形式存储,给出此二叉树建立过程算法(可不描述结构体)。
已知一个二叉树,用二叉链表形式存储,给出此二叉树建立过程算法(可不描述结构体)。
admin
2019-08-15
55
问题
已知一个二叉树,用二叉链表形式存储,给出此二叉树建立过程算法(可不描述结构体)。
选项
答案
二叉树是递归定义的,以递归方式建立最简单。二叉树建立过程如下: BiTree Creat(){ //建立二叉树的二叉链表形式的存储结构 ElemType x: BiTree bt; scanf(”%d",&x); //本题假定结点数据域为整型 if(x==0)bt=null; else if(x>0){ bt=(BiNode*)malloc(sizeof(BiNode)); bt一>data=x: bt->lchild=Creat(); bt一>rchild=Creat(): } else error(”输入错误”); return(bt); }//结束BiTree
解析
转载请注明原文地址:https://www.kaotiyun.com/show/DcCi777K
本试题收录于:
计算机408题库学硕统考专业分类
0
计算机408
学硕统考专业
相关试题推荐
下列关于20世纪历史的叙述,全部错误的是()。①朝鲜建国的时间早于中国②1948年3月,英国、法国、比利时、荷兰、卢森堡5国缔结了《合作和集体防御条约》即《五国和约》③1950年,周恩来到达莫斯科,中苏缔结了《中苏互不侵犯条约》,标志着社会主
北宋在统一南方割据势力的过程中特设(),把征南所得的财富统一存放,以作日后恢复幽燕之费。
周王室的两大官僚系统是()。
隋唐五代时期是中国古代商品经济发展史上的一个重要阶段,种类多,交换规模大,交换方式多。试回答问题:随着商业的发展,唐朝在货币和金融方面有一些重要的进步,以下表述全面的是()
以下()协议完成了从网卡到IP地址的映射。
一个SPOOUNG系统由输入进程I、用户进程P、输出进程O、输入缓冲区、输出缓冲区组成。进程I通过输入缓冲区为进程P输入数据,进程P的处理结果通过输出缓冲区交给进程O输出。进程间数据交换以等长度的数据块为单位,这些数据块均存储在同一个磁盘上,因此,SPOO
已知在二叉树中,T为根结点,*p和*q为二叉树中两个结点,试编写求距离它们最近的共同祖先的算法。
测量控制系统中的数据采集任务把所采集的数据送一个单缓冲区,计算任务从该单缓冲区中取出数据进行计算。试写出利用信号量机制实现两者共享单缓冲区的同步算法。
试比较脱机I/O和联机I/O。
随机试题
下列选项中,小额信贷的提供者不包括()。
在公共场合下,大众心理现象的表现形式有【 】
根据行政复议法律制度的规定,下列有关行政复议申请人的表述中,正确的是()。
上市公司甲公司是ABC会计师事务所的常年审计客户,主要从事电子商务业务。A注册会计师负责审计甲公司2015年度财务报表,确定财务报表整体的重要性为600万元,实际执行重要性为360万元,明显微小错报临界值为30万元。资料一:A注册会计师
设数列{an}的前n项和Sn=n2,则an的值为________。
古人云:“不登高山,不知山之高也;不临深渊,不知地之厚也。”这句话说明()。
书是读不尽的,即使读尽也没有用,许多书都没有读的价值。多读一本没有价值的书,便丧失可读一本有价值的书的时间和精力。作者想要表达的观点是()。
把戏:伎俩:手段
下列关于CiscoAironet1100进入快速配置步骤的描述中,错误的是()。
Whenwilltheconference(finish)______?
最新回复
(
0
)